Advantages of HEVs Use less oil than ICE Emit less CO2 than ICE Fuel efficiency increased Honda Insight- 700 mi/tank Toyota Prius- 500 mi/tank Honda Civic Hybrid- 650 mi/tank

Fuel (estimate d per year) Vehicle emissions (estimated per year in pounds) Consumpti on Carbon dioxide Carbon monoxide Nitrogen oxides Hydro carbons 2003 Honda Civic Hybrid (47.7 mpg, SULEV) 12,500 miles/yr 263Gal 5,089 lb 79.9 lb 0.8 lb 2003 Honda Civic (33.8 mpg, ULEV) 12,500 miles/yr 370 Gal 7,176 lb 135 lb 7.4 lb 3 lb HEV info.
